右侧
当前位置:网站首页 > 资讯 > 正文

foreach遍历数组,foreach遍历数组详解JAVA

作者:admin 发布时间:2024-02-05 11:30 分类:资讯 浏览:27 评论:0


导读:php里面用foreach遍历数组,如何知道遍历到了最后一个值?1、PHPforeach语法foreach循环只适用于数组,并用于遍历数组中的每个键/值对。2、在本示例中,通过...

php里面用foreach遍历数组,如何知道遍历到了最后一个值?

1、PHPforeach语法foreach循环只适用于数组,并用于遍历数组中的每个键/值对。

2、在本示例中,通过 foreach 循环遍历数组 $arr,并通过 if 语句检查每个元素是否为 0。

3、foreach用法:foreach (type identifier in expression) statement。其中:type:identifier 的类型。identifier:表示集合元素的迭代变量。如果迭代变量为值类型,则无法修改的只读变量也是有效的。expression:对象集合或数组表达式。

4、mybatis 使用 foreach 在遍历数组参数的时候,在最后一次不需要一些关键字,这个时候就需要对 foreach 的最后一次循环进行判断。使用 index 进行判断。

foreach是什么意思

foreach n.循环数组或集合中的对象、数据;[网络]遍历数组;循环;遍历;[例句]Another change is the replacement of the blocking operations such as Average and ForEach.另一个改变是替换了Average和ForEach等阻塞操作。

foreach 语句为数组或对象集合中的每个元素重复一个嵌入语句组。支持的语言:Java、C# 、PHP、D语言(Phobos库)等。该语句可以与for进行等价替换。

习惯上将这种特殊的for语句格式称之为“foreach”语句,从英文字面意思理解foreach也就是“for 每一个”的意思,实际上也就是这个意思。下面通过一个简单例子看看foreach是如何简化编程的。

如何用foreach做数组个数的遍历

第一种格式遍历给定数组$array,每次循环,当前单元的值被赋给 $value 并且数组内部的指针向前移一步(下一次循环中将会得到下一个单元)。第二种格式也是遍历给定的数组$array,不同的是键名也参与了。

第一种格式遍历给定的 $a 数组。每次循环中,当前单元的值被赋给 $b 并且数组内部的指针向前移一步(因此下一次循环中将会得到下一个单元)。自 PHP 5 起,可以很容易地通过在 $b 之前加上 & 来修改数组的单元。

数组遍历就用foreach了。三维只是遍历三次而已。原理是一样。

在echo 前加个计数变量,并通过判断计数的大小来决定是否显示。

标签:


取消回复欢迎 发表评论: